When error task list is full, print the process info where
the error task come from for debug usage.

Signed-off-by: Qiang Yu <yuq...@gmail.com>
---
 drivers/gpu/drm/lima/lima_sched.c | 3 ++-
 1 file changed, 2 insertions(+), 1 deletion(-)

diff --git a/drivers/gpu/drm/lima/lima_sched.c 
b/drivers/gpu/drm/lima/lima_sched.c
index a2db1c937424..387f9439450a 100644
--- a/drivers/gpu/drm/lima/lima_sched.c
+++ b/drivers/gpu/drm/lima/lima_sched.c
@@ -285,7 +285,8 @@ static void lima_sched_build_error_task_list(struct 
lima_sched_task *task)
        mutex_lock(&dev->error_task_list_lock);
 
        if (dev->dump.num_tasks >= lima_max_error_tasks) {
-               dev_info(dev->dev, "fail to save task state: error task list is 
full\n");
+               dev_info(dev->dev, "fail to save task state from %s pid %d: "
+                        "error task list is full\n", ctx->pname, ctx->pid);
                goto out;
        }
 
-- 
2.17.1

_______________________________________________
dri-devel mailing list
dri-devel@lists.freedesktop.org
https://lists.freedesktop.org/mailman/listinfo/dri-devel

Reply via email to